15 years ago something happened to me that would turn out to be the the biggest blessing of my life!  I was 40 years old,  lying in a hospital bed, hooked up to an oxygen machine  in  the Cardiac Care Center at Mount Carmel hospital. This doesn't sound like much of a blessing does it? Stick with me,  it really was!
 Doctors, Nurses; prodding, poking, drawing blood, and worse yet, Blood Gasses! I don't know if your familiar with this procedure? Its very similar to getting a root canal with a black and decker power drill. Being checked  for hyrnea, by a gorilla using channel lock plyers. While also getting a  prostate exam by  Freddie Krueger, all at the same time! So yeah, pretty unpleasant to say the least!
Worse than all the  testing I was going through was the Diagnosis. Congestive Heart Failure, Brought on by pulmonary adema and a aeortic Heart aneurism! All very terrifying things! Basically in average Joe language, my heart could no longer circulate my blood efficiently. Especially to my lower extremeties, so fluid would back up. I was drowning in my own body! 
I went into  the Mount Carmel Heart unit weighing in at 420lbs! I had been struggling with just the simple task of walking my Daughter from the car, to her 2nd grade class room around 50 yards. This walk would leave me Gassping frantically for air! 
I had a little  hack I remember using to catch my breath. The Elementary Schools Bulletin Board was right across the hall from her class room. I would stand there reading it for several minutes, until I could catch my breath. I could pretty much recite the cafeteria menu and knew every pta function on the calendar. Once I got enough breath,  I would struggle my way back to the car. There I would collapse in the seat. Gasping for air, until I could breath well enough to drive Home! This scenario went on over and over, every day for a few weeks!
Then came my Daughters class  trip to the zoo. Parents were encouraged to come of course. Madison (My Daughter) begged me to go. How could I say no? I came up with the big, bright, genius plan. I took some cold medicine  and a pack of halls mentho lyptus cough drops with me. I attempted to keep my airwaves open, thinking I would be able to breathe by doing this. That day it was 87 degrees at the Columbus Zoo with 100 percent humidity. By the time I made it from the parking lot, through the front gate, I was struggling violently to breath. My heart was beating like the opening drum beat to 
Vanhalens, "hot for teacher"!  My Daughter and I never saw a single animal at the zoo that day!
Later that  afternoon, I was admitted to Mount Carmel hospital.
  The Doctors were very blunt with there diagnoses. The Doctor at the heart center said, "Had I waited any longer to come, I would have Died". Basically, in my condition even admitted in the hospital I was still ringing Deaths doorbell.  Due to the damage to my lungs and heart, I was told I  wouldn't be able to Work again. Also, ordinary  everyday tasks I had previously taken for granted would be challenging. If not impossible for me! 
  I spent over a week in The Mount Carmel Heart Clinic. Considering I had no Health coverage, that was very generous of them. Also a blessing that they gave me such care. It spoke volumes on the grave seriousness of my condition. I was released with a order of 24-7 Oxygen. More medications than you can imagine. Heart pills, blood thinners, blood pressure pills, water pills, 2 different inhalers , a breathing treatment machine, and medicine for my type 2 Diabetes. That  later would progress into insulin dependent, type 2 Diabetes.
 My Health battle would rage on for the next 10 years. Literally a grocery bag full of medication every month. These kept me just well enough to stay on this side of the dirt!

   There  are two major types of Motivation. Push motivation, and Pull Motivation.
   Let me explain the difference.  Have you ever had someone insult you? Maybe make fun of you for your inability to do something well or not as good as someone else?  Your response, even if just to yourself was; I'll show them! That's push motivation. I have a quick story from my own life that gives a perfect example of push Motivation. About 6 months into my weightloss and fitness journey, I had lost about 45 lbs. Feeling pretty good about my progress, I was actually starting to feel some pride!  Something I hadn't felt in quite sometime!  My Ex wife, for liability reasons I won't mention her name. For this story's purpose let's call her Beelzebub.
  So one day,  Beelzebub caught me looking at my self in the mirror. You would think  anybody would encourage someone trying to improve themselves and be supportive. No, not Beelzebub. Her response to me was, "congratulations, you lost just enough  weight to be a fat guy". "Maybe if you try really hard, you can lose enough weight to be almost a normal man"!  Wow, what a kick in the head that was!  I let those words burn into my heart and mind! I used those words. As hurtful as they were, I used them to motivate myself. To push myself away from, and to make sure I never heard things like that again!  Fear and panic are other forms of push motivation. Fear can be a very powerful motivator! The problem with push motivators they aren't long term or sustainable. They can be detrimental to your mental health. Causing anxiety and depression! Be very careful if you choose to you use hurt and fear to motivate yourself! You may cause yourself more problems in the long run! 
  
  That brings us to pull Motivators. These are always positive. Pull Motivation is when you focus on the desired result or outcome. For example, how your life will be better when you achieve your goal. All the positive changes that will come with achieving it! 
  Pull Motivation is very sustainable and long lasting since its based on the positive. Pull Motivators are very powerful!  Yes, of course I have a personal example of pull Motivation to share. Have you ever noticed a insult or negative remark directed towards you tends to stick with you much longer than Compliments or positive remarks? Ever wondered why you just can't let go of those nasty remarks someone threw at you? They seem to just take up space in your mind until they Rot and start to stink! While something Nice someone said to you can never seem to rest for long in your mind?  This is Because Negative emotions involve more thinking and  reasoning even if your overthinking the insult to convince yourself  it's not true you are still giving it way to much thought.
The worse part  if your putting that insult on trial in your mind both sides, positive and negative are going to present there  case , and guess what ? The Negatives are going to  seem to present a very strong case!
How many  of us have ever felt sick and googled our symptoms? Not the best way to diagnose yourself. How many of us have done that and freaked ourselves out with the possible prognosis? perfect example of the power of negative thoughts!
Phycologist say Negative thoughts weigh up to three times more in our minds than positive thoughts. This really isn't our fault it's kind of hardwired in us it's what Gave our cave dwelling ancestors , a fighting chance in a world where they were on the Dinner menu!
So How can we combat a Genetic Tendency that dates back to the stone age?
A few tips that I have found useful
Savor every Compliment. Big  or small focus on them keep them fresh in your mind for several minutes after you receive them. Remember every word of a compliment or every minute of a positive event. Replay them over and over in your mind.This will make them stickier and quicker to recall when you need them.
Stay in a state of Gratitude, think of any and all The Good things in your life, big or small. Make a mental list for that matter write them down and carry them in your pocket.
It's Extremely hard if not impossible to be Negative when you are in a state of Gratitude!
  Focus on your Breath in times of stress and overwhelming Negativity, breath in positivity and happiness, breath out stress and Negativity. Reapeat this over and over until the Stress and Negativity pass. I know it may sound silly at first . It does really work,
  Buddhist Monks have been using this practice for centuries!
  Live in the Moment, since fear, stress, and Negativity tend to dwell in the past or threaten from  the future.Unless you are in immenent and immediate danger, realize in this very moment, right here, right now, they have no power!
